Does anyone work in HR or management? Just trying to clear something up...

I know if you work over 6 hours, you're entitled to a lunch break (my work don't pay for lunch breaks).

What if you work exactly 6 hours? Are you entitled to a lunch break then, or not?

I'm thinking about requesting a change to my working pattern when I go back, but it hinges on whether I'd get paid for 6hrs or 5.5hrs for working 8:30 to 2:30.

I'm in the UK.

Employment laws here require a minimum 20 minute break if you work over 6 hours, but I'm not clear on 6 hours itself.
